Transaction 7b45dff7512894a7417bf5950885617732306130fd83c6feaf58935f1117ff5a

23 Input
2 Outputs
  • 7b45dff7512894a7417bf5950885617732306130fd83c6feaf58935f1117ff5a:0
  • value  68000000
    address  1L8Caj4f9RijRJ9S3vQoZjXGEfp96eGWbj
  • 7b45dff7512894a7417bf5950885617732306130fd83c6feaf58935f1117ff5a:1
  • value  172057
    address  bc1qfd4xsr30avng424cjgel707hxwm9z2pxce396v